What you will be doing:
As an IT Support Analyst, you'll be the go-to person for technical queries across the Edinburgh site, while also working closely with colleagues at other CLS locations. You will:
* Deliver first and second line support for desktops, laptops, mobile devices, and core business applications.
* Support Microsoft 365, Active Directory, and other enterprise systems used across the company.
* Assist with user onboarding, device deployment, and system configuration.
* Help maintain network connectivity, security, and backup solutions.
* Take part in IT projects, from system upgrades to security improvements, ensuring tasks are completed on time and to a high standard.
* Provide clear communication and excellent customer service to staff at all levels.

Requirements:
* Strong Windows OS troubleshooting skills (Windows 10/11).
* Proficiency in Microsoft 365 and Azure Active Directory.
* Knowledge of cyber threat landscape and countermeasures.
* Familiarity with networking (DNS, DHCP, IP routing).
* Ability to support 200+ user environments onsite and remotely.
Advantageous Requirements:
While we value expertise in all IT areas, candidates with knowledge in the following areas are preferred:
* Microsoft 365/Azure administration.
* Windows Server management.
* Storage management (NAS or SAN).
* Mobile device support (Tablet, Android/iPhone).
* Backup and replication software (Veeam)
* Knowledge of Cyber Essentials or ISO27001.
* Interest or experience in Cyber Security platforms/techniques or risk Management.

About Us:
We are a multi-disciplined Contract Research Organisation based in the UK, providing market-leading scientific services globally. Over the past 25 years, Concept Life Sciences and its heritage companies have played a pivotal role in guiding numerous clients along their path to clinical success and many of these clients have evolved into enduring scientific collaborators. Driven by a team of expert scientists, has led to significant growth and advancement in the industry. We're dedicated to making a difference and believe that integrated science is the key to achieving our goals.
